Words of the last movement of the 9th symphony by Friedrich Schiller; sung in German.
Performer Wiener Philharmoniker; Leonard Bernstein, conductor; with, in the 9th symphony: Gwyneth Jones, soprano; Hanna Schwarz, contralto; René Kollo, tenor; Kurt Moll, bass; Konzertvereinigung Wiener Staatsopernchor.
Event Recorded live, Sept. 1977 (5th work), Feb. 1978 (2nd-3rd works), Nov. 1978 (1st, 4th, and 6th-8th works), Grosser Saal, Musikverein, Vienna; and Sept. 1979, Staatsoper, Vienna (9th work).
Note Originally released in 1980.
Compact disc.
Program notes by the conductor and Jed Distler, in English with German and French translations, and text with English and French translations (22 p. : ports.) inserted in container.
Contents No. 1 in C major, op. 21 (26:40) -- No. 3 in E flat major, op. 55 : Eroica (53:23) -- No. 2 in D major, op. 36 (35:49) -- No. 4 in B flat major, op. 60 (34:17) -- No. 5 in C minor, op. 67 (35:37) -- No. 6 in F major, op. 68 : Pastoral (44:38) -- No. 7 in A major, op. 92 (39:08) -- No. 8 in F major, op. 93 (26:01) -- No. 9 in D minor, op. 125 (71:04).
